Job Description
Eligibility to participate on CE is generally linked to those who are 21 years or over and in receipt of a qualifying social welfare payment for 1 year or more or 18 years and over for certain disadvantaged groups. Your eligibility will have to be verified by the Department.
To register your interest you can contact an Employment Personal Advisor (EPA) in your local Intreo Centre.
Responsibilities
Provide direct delivery of information, advice, advocacy and referral services in accordance with Citizens Information Board guidelines.
Complete all necessary follow‑up work arising from client contacts.
Assist the Manager in developing innovative processes for the provision of quality information to clients.
Liaise and cooperate with other providers of information, advice, advocacy and referral services – statutory and voluntary.
Operate the organisation’s query management system (OYSTER) and agreed systems for monitoring and evaluation of the service.
Assist in research and/or social policy initiatives appropriate to the development of the service.
Contribute to completion of administrative tasks generally.
Undertake duties assigned from time to time by the Development Manager.
Undertake publicity and promotional initiatives appropriate to the development of the service.
Full training will be provided.
